Output d5667a9f31eeed705e43fafa3355c2308bfbac2dc2a04ef920fd6dfba18cefd9:5

value
256010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bd80c193a05882f9c3caee40f2041174e5501f2 OP_EQUAL
address
38c3RA7A9cQA9wprbFERK94HTDVJozoLzF
transaction
d5667a9f31eeed705e43fafa3355c2308bfbac2dc2a04ef920fd6dfba18cefd9
confirmations
485748
spent
true